Trocadero £50m refurbishment opens tomorrow, in Piccadilly, London

The Trocadero, in London’s Piccadilly Circus is relaunched tomorrow. The leisure complex has undergone a £50m refurbishment that includes installing an atrium and banks of video screens inside to create a futuristic feel.

SegaWorld, a £45m game centre is due to open in September. A theme cafe, based on Marvel comic characters is planned in the next year. The complex will also have Imax, the first 3-D cinema in London and other attractions based on characters in Enid Blyton stories.

The centre has benefited from being hived off from the Burford property group last autumn as a separate AIM company.
